Palomar College art gallery We are a contemporary art gallery serving Palomar College and North County San Diego. Director- Ingram Ober
We feature work by emerging and established local, national,and international artists. We are committed to participating in current dialogues in all genera of the fine arts.

We are so pleased to announce the Boehm Gallery is reopening to the public! Our First, long awaited, exhibition is "Val Sanders and the Val Pals" an exhibition celebrating Palomar College emeritus Faculty Val Sanders and his enduring legacy and relationship with former students working in the arts throughout the region.
